Erin is committed to empowering communities of color to challenge poverty, disenfranchisement, and the criminal injustice system.
Erin is the Civic Engagement Coordinator for Blueprint NC. Blueprint NC is a partnership of state-level public policy, advocacy, and grassroots groups dedicated to achieving a better, fairer, healthier North Carolina.
She also works with the Exchange Project, a program in the School of Public Health at UNC in Chapel Hill, Prison MATCH (Mothers and Their Children), Black Workers for Justice and the Fruit of Labor Singing Ensemble. She is the treasurer of the NC Black Leadership Caucus and is on the board of Southern Partners Fund, a foundation that supports the work of community organizers across the south.
Erin is the former Executive Director of Southerners for Economic Justice (SEJ) and NC Voters for Clean Elections Coalition, where she worked as the coordinator to pass the first judicial public financing legislation for judges in the United States.
Erin is a graduated from the College of William and Mary in Virginia and currently lives in Raleigh.
